Subject: [PATCH v5] Add log_object_drops GUC for DROP TABLE/DATABASE logging
New GUC logs DROP TABLE and DROP DATABASE with commit LSN.
Extends XactCallback to pass LSN. Handles subtransactions correctly.
Includes TAP tests.

+ <varlistentry id="guc-log_object_drops" xreflabel="log_object_drops">
+ <term><varname>log_object_drops</varname> (<type>boolean</type>)
+ <indexterm>
+ <primary><varname>log_object_drops</varname> configuration parameter</primary>
+ </indexterm>
+ </term>
+ <listitem>
+ <para>
+ Causes <command>DROP TABLE</command> and <command>DROP DATABASE</command>
+ operations to be logged with their commit LSN (Log Sequence Number).
+ The commit LSN represents the point in the write-ahead log where the
+ drop operation becomes durable and visible to other transactions.
+ </para>
+
+ <para>
+ Each logged entry includes the schema name, table name, OID, and the
+ commit LSN. For example:
+ <programlisting>
+ LOG: DROP TABLE: relation "public.employees" (OID 16384), LSN: 0/15D4A48
+ LOG: DROP DATABASE: database "testdb" (OID 16385), LSN: 0/15D4B20
+ </programlisting>
+ </para>
+
+ <para>
+ Logged operations include: direct <command>DROP TABLE</command> statements,
+ tables dropped via <command>DROP SCHEMA CASCADE</command>,
+ partitioned tables and their partitions, tables in inheritance hierarchies,
+ and <command>DROP DATABASE</command> commands.
+ Operations that are rolled back (via <command>ROLLBACK</command> or
+ <command>ROLLBACK TO SAVEPOINT</command>) are not logged.
+ </para>
+
+ <para>
+ This parameter is useful for tracking and auditing destructive operations,
+ and for coordinating with external systems that monitor the write-ahead log.
+ Note that enabling this option may generate substantial log volume
+ when dropping schemas or databases containing many tables.
+ </para>
+
+ <para>
+ The default is <literal>off</literal>. Only superusers and users with
+ the appropriate <literal>SET</literal> privilege can change this setting.
+ </para>
+ </listitem>
+ </varlistentry>
